The Mobile Imaging market is a rapidly growing sector of the Smartphone and Mobile Device industry. It encompasses the development and production of cameras, lenses, and other imaging components for use in mobile devices. This includes the development of new technologies such as dual-camera systems, image stabilization, and high-resolution sensors. Additionally, the market includes the production of software and applications for image processing, editing, and sharing. The Mobile Imaging market is driven by the increasing demand for high-quality images and videos from mobile devices. This has led to the development of new technologies and components to improve the image quality of mobile devices. Additionally, the increasing popularity of social media and other online platforms has further increased the demand for high-quality images and videos from mobile devices. Companies in the Mobile Imaging market include Apple, Samsung, Huawei, LG, Sony, and Google.
